Leavitt: Midterms a Choice Between Communism and Sense

Source: The Hill Politics

Summary

White House press secretary Karoline Leavitt characterized the upcoming midterm elections as a stark choice between ‘communism and common sense’ due to recent progressive successes in Democratic primaries. She emphasized concerns among Americans regarding the Democratic Party’s leftward shift.

Why It Matters

Leavitt’s remarks highlight the growing ideological divide in American politics, particularly as the midterm elections approach. With rising progressive candidates gaining traction, her statements reflect a strategy aimed at galvanizing conservative voters to counteract what they perceive as extreme liberal policies.
